The size of Kilmore is approximately 58 square kilometres. It has 21 parks covering nearly 2.7% of total area. The population of Kilmore in 2011 was 6,677 people. By 2016 the population was 7,972 showing a population growth of 19.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Kilmore is 10-19 years. Households in Kilmore are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Kilmore work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 74.8% of the homes in Kilmore were owner-occupied compared with 72.1% in 2016.
